Excerpt from Lectures on Missions and Evangelism: Delivered to the Students of the Senior Hall of the United Presbyterian Church All power given to Christ in heaven - all power given to Christ on earth - the commission, Go ye into all the world the authority with which Christ's sent servants are invested - the work which they are to do - the promise of Christ's gracious presence to the end of the world.
